We investigated the impact of GLUT2 gene inactivation on the regulation of hepatic glucose
metabolism during the fed to fast transition. In control and GLUT2-null mice, fasting was
accompanied by a∼ 10-fold increase in plasma glucagon to insulin ratio, a similar activation
of liver glycogen phosphorylase and inhibition of glycogen synthase and the same elevation
in ph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ase and glucose-6-phosphatase mRNAs. In GLUT2-null
mice, mobilization of glycogen stores was, however, strongly impaired. This was correlated …
